Many of the contract doctors who participated in HartalDoktorKontrak have returned to their work station to continue with patient care. According to several medical officers, they returned to work because they do not want patients to be neglected.

Many of the government contract doctors who participated in this morning's strike have returned to their work station to continue with patient care.

They include those who are attached to the Sungai Buloh Hospital and Covid-19 quarantine and low-risk treatment centre at the Malaysian Agro Exposition Park Serdang , which are the main Health Ministry facilities that treat Covid-19 positive patients."Yes, most of the doctors who participated in this hartal...
